Hi motoring people,
i have a forklift mid eighties mitsubishi petrol/lpg.
Issue One - yesterday it was going fine then turned it off and went back and it would not go. no click when i pressed the starter so i shorted a couple of terminals on the solanoid and the starter motor gave a growl so i tried the starter button again and away she went. this morning it wouldnt start and the terminal trick didnt work so i turned the flywheel/ring gear (!) a wee bit and then it went again.so from these symtoms does it need a new starter motor or solanoid or both or is there something else going on!

Issue 2 - as mentioned it is lpg/petrol but due to our location we only run it on petrol.when it is running on petrol and quite warm it carries on spluttering when the ignition is turned off but it doesnt do this on lpg, would this be a tuning issue! i have tried the distributor in various positions to no avail as this was suggested to me. any ideas how i could stop this happening!
thanks

meathead_timaru, Mar 6, 3:11pm
1) Sounds like starter motor brushes.
2) Yes, a tuning problem. The reason it won't do it on LPG is the fuel is shut off by a solenoid. Set the timing properly and try a lower idle speed.

strobo, Mar 6, 3:26pm
needs a dual curve ignition system fittedas well as wot meathead said above. /gas lock offsolenoid valve could be leaky too

bigfatmat1, Mar 6, 3:37pm
its a f/lift it does not need one. Op yes sounds like starter those starters are pretty cheap new so maybe a easy option for ya get a sparky in and as above sounds like needs a tune . just for reference starter is only engaged during start turning engine will have no affect on starter purely coincidental .only time it will is if the ring gear is screwed or drive is stuffed. issue one sounds like the starter motor needs replacing or checking rebuild.
issue 2 is caused by low octane crap fuel as it be tuned for lpg you need 98 octane fuel and a bottle injector cleaner as a startpoint .
what you discribe is called dieseling
